Video Feedback in Cognitive Therapy for Social Anxiety (demo clip)

7-minute video clip that illustrates some of the procedures described for using video feedback in cognitive therapy for social anxiety disorder. The role-played clip is based on a real cognitive therapy session that took 90 minutes. The clip illustrates: (1) Identifying a patient’s predictions in advance of viewing a video; (2) Preparing the patient to view the video; (3) Discussing the video and rewinding to capture key moments; (4) Comparing ratings before and after viewing the video; and (5) Freezing the moment of disconfirmation and consolidating learning.

Video patients/clients are portrayed by actors.
